A recruitment agency seeks an Interim Finance Manager in the United Kingdom to manage a small finance team, improve purchase ledger processes, and enhance approval workflows. This role emphasizes systems and process improvements within the education sector. Ideal candidates will have proven experience and a passion for education. Flexible day rates are available, with an immediate or short-notice start preferred.
